What I Consider Before Buying
Before I choose a lip product, I always think about a few important things. I look at the shade range, texture, staying power, and whether it feels moisturizing on my lips. I also want to know if it suits my daily routine. If I can apply it quickly and still look polished, that is a big plus for me.
Texture and Comfort
One of the first things I notice in a lip stick like this is how it feels on my lips. I prefer a formula that glides smoothly and does not tug or dry out my lips. If the Colour Juice Stick gives me a soft, creamy finish, that makes it much easier for me to wear it throughout the day.
Shade Selection
For me, the right shade makes all the difference. I usually look for colors that match my skin tone and the kind of look I want, whether that is natural, fresh, or a little more bold. A good buying choice means picking a shade I know I will actually use often, not just one that looks nice in the package.
Wear Time and Reapplication
I do not expect every lip product to last forever, but I do want something dependable. If I have to reapply a lip stick, I want it to be easy and not messy. I personally prefer products that fade evenly, so I do not end up with patchy color after a few hours.
Everyday Use vs. Special Occasions
I think about where I plan to wear it most. If I want something for daily use, I look for a shade and finish that feels subtle and versatile. If I want it for events or outings, I may choose a brighter or more noticeable color. That helps me get better value from my purchase.
Packaging and Portability
I also care about how easy it is to carry around. A stick format is convenient for me because I can keep it in my bag and apply it quickly when needed. I like packaging that feels sturdy, closes properly, and does not create a mess in my purse.
Value for Money
When I buy a lip product, I always ask myself whether it feels worth the price. I look at how often I will use it, how comfortable it feels, and whether the color and quality meet my expectations. A good buy for me is one that balances performance, convenience, and cost.
